The vietnam transistors market was estimated at USD 1062 Million in 2025 and is projected to reach USD 1517 Million by 2032, growing at a CAGR of 8.3% from 2026 to 2032.
The transistors market in Vietnam has exhibited a robust upward trend, marked by significant growth rates such as 3.4% in 2022 and an impressive 8.4% in 2023. This acceleration can be attributed to increased investments in the electronics sector, driven by the rising consumer demand for advanced digital devices. As Vietnam enhances its industrial capabilities and infrastructure, projected growth rates continue to stabilize, with expected figures of 5.7% in 2024 and 7.0% in 2025. Moreover, the government's emphasis on energy transition and technology adoption is creating favorable conditions for innovation, thereby fostering an environment ripe for continued expansion through 2032.

The Vietnamese government has implemented several policies aimed at enhancing the growth of the transistors market. These initiatives include significant public spending on digital infrastructure and incentives for technology firms focusing on semiconductor development. The government is also fostering collaborations between educational institutions and industries to promote innovation in electronics. Additionally, efforts to attract foreign direct investments (FDI) in the technology sector are reinforcing Vietnam's stature as a competitive player in the global semiconductor landscape. These measures not only create a conducive environment for local manufacturers but also attract international players to invest in Vietnam's burgeoning electronics ecosystem.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
